I need help with this circle Geometry question, I got a and b but need help with c.

I need help with this circle Geometry question, I got a and b but need help with c.

On
i. As $\angle BFH=\angle BDH=\frac{\pi}{2}$, $BFHD$ is cyclic with $(BH)$ being the diameter of the circumscribed circle. Similarly, as $\angle CFA=\angle CDA=\frac{\pi}{2}$, $AFDC$ is cyclic with $(AC)$ being the diameter of the circumscribed circle.
ii. $\angle GBF\equiv\underbrace{\angle GBA=\angle GCA}_{\bigcirc ABC}\equiv \underbrace{\angle FCA=\angle FDA}_{\bigcirc AFDC}\equiv \underbrace{\angle FDH=\angle FBH}_{\bigcirc BFHD}$.
iii. $(BF)$ is both angle bisector and altitude of $\triangle GBH \Rightarrow$ $\triangle GBH$ - isosceles $\Rightarrow BG= BH$. Similarly $\triangle KBH$ - isosceles $\Rightarrow BH=BK$.
(i) is easy and acts as a hint to the parts that follow.
(ii) $\angle GBF = \angle GCA$ (angles in the same segment)
$ \angle GCA = \angle HDF$ (for the same reason and is a result from (i))
$ \angle HDF = \angle HBF$ (for the same reason as above).
(iii) Both chords subtends equal angles (ie. $\angle BCG = \angle BAK$)
Added: If two chords of the same circle are respectively subtended by the same sized angle(s) on the circumference, these two chords must be equal in length.